PI74LCX16245AE Equivalent & Substitute Parts
Part Overview
The PI74LCX16245AE is a non-inverting transceiver logic IC manufactured by Diodes Incorporated, featuring 2 elements with 8 bits per element and 3-state output capability. This device operates across a supply voltage range of 2V to 3.6V and is housed in a 48-TSSOP package. The part is currently classified as obsolete, making equivalent and substitute parts necessary for ongoing design support and production continuity.

Substitute Part Grouping Explanation
Substitution eligibility for the PI74LCX16245AE is determined by the following critical parameters:
Core Functional Parameters:
- Logic Type: Transceiver, Non-Inverting
- Number of Elements: 2
- Number of Bits per Element: 8
- Output Type: 3-State
- Current - Output High, Low: 24mA, 24mA
Electrical Parameters:
- Voltage - Supply: 2V ~ 3.6V (minimum requirement)
- Operating Temperature: -40°C ~ 85°C (TA)
Physical Parameters:
- Package / Case: 48-TFSOP (0.240", 6.10mm Width) or compatible 48-pin packages
- Mounting Type: Surface Mount
Compliance Parameters:
- RoHS Status: ROHS3 Compliant
- Moisture Sensitivity Level (MSL): 1 (Unlimited) preferred for direct replacement
Substitute parts are grouped into two categories based on package compatibility:
Category 1: 48-TFSOP Package (Direct Pin-Compatible) Parts maintaining the exact 48-TFSOP footprint with identical electrical specifications.
Category 2: 48-SSOP Package (Alternate Package) Parts with equivalent electrical specifications but different physical package dimensions (48-BSSOP, 0.295", 7.50mm Width). These require PCB layout modification.

Engineering Selection Recommendations
Primary Recommendation: 74LCX16245MTDX (onsemi)
This part is the preferred direct replacement. It maintains identical electrical specifications (2V ~ 3.6V supply, 24mA output current) and package configuration (48-TFSOP). The part is currently in active production status with 32,954 units in stock. MSL rating of 2 (1 Year) is acceptable for most applications. ROHS3 compliance and EAR99 classification match the original part.
Secondary Recommendation: SN74LVC16245ADGGR (Texas Instruments)
This part offers enhanced specifications with extended operating temperature range (-40°C ~ 125°C) and lower minimum supply voltage (1.65V ~ 3.6V). It is actively produced with 65,188 units in stock. The 48-TFSOP package provides direct PCB compatibility. MSL rating of 1 (Unlimited) and ROHS3 compliance ensure reliability. This option is suitable when extended temperature performance is required.
Alternative for 48-TFSOP Package: 74LVC16245APAG8 (Renesas Electronics)
This part maintains the 48-TFSOP footprint with 2,900 units available. Supply voltage range of 2.7V ~ 3.6V is compatible with the original specification. MSL rating of 1 (Unlimited) and ROHS3 compliance are equivalent to the original part.
Package Variant: 74LVC16245APVG8 (Renesas Electronics)
For applications where package size adjustment is acceptable, this part offers active production status in a 48-SSOP package. The 48-BSSOP footprint (0.295", 7.50mm Width) differs from the original 48-TFSOP, requiring PCB redesign. MSL rating of 3 (168 Hours) requires controlled storage conditions.
Obsolete Status Consideration: M74LCX16245DTR2G (onsemi)
While this part shares the same series and specifications as the original, it is classified as obsolete. Use only if existing inventory is available and long-term supply is not required.
Frequently Asked Questions (FAQ)
Q: Can I use SN74LVC16245ADGGR as a direct replacement for PI74LCX16245AE?
A: Yes. Both parts feature identical logic type (Transceiver, Non-Inverting), element configuration (2 elements, 8 bits per element), output type (3-State), and output current (24mA). The 48-TFSOP package is pin-compatible. The SN74LVC16245ADGGR offers extended operating temperature range (-40°C ~ 125°C versus -40°C ~ 85°C) and lower minimum supply voltage (1.65V versus 2V), making it functionally superior for most applications.
Q: What is the difference between 74LVC16245APAG and 74LVC16245APAG8?
A: Both parts are electrically identical with the same specifications and 48-TFSOP package. The primary difference is packaging format: 74LVC16245APAG is supplied in Tube packaging, while 74LVC16245APAG8 is supplied in Tape & Reel (TR) format. Selection depends on assembly process requirements and quantity needs.
Q: Why do some substitute parts have different supply voltage ranges?
A: The original PI74LCX16245AE operates at 2V ~ 3.6V. Some substitutes, such as SN74LVC16245ADGGR, operate at 1.65V ~ 3.6V. This represents an extended lower voltage capability. Parts with 2.7V ~ 3.6V ranges (such as 74LVC16245APAG) have a higher minimum voltage but remain compatible with the original specification since 2.7V falls within the 2V ~ 3.6V range.
Q: Can I use 74LVC16245APVG8 if my PCB is designed for 48-TFSOP?
A: No. The 74LVC16245APVG8 uses a 48-SSOP package (48-BSSOP, 0.295", 7.50mm Width), which differs from the original 48-TFSOP (0.240", 6.10mm Width). PCB layout modification is required. Use only if redesign is feasible.
Q: What does MSL rating mean for component selection?
A: Moisture Sensitivity Level (MSL) indicates how long a component can be stored in standard conditions before requiring baking. MSL 1 (Unlimited) allows indefinite storage. MSL 2 (1 Year) requires use within one year of packaging. MSL 3 (168 Hours) requires use within one week. For the PI74LCX16245AE replacement, MSL 1 or MSL 2 are preferred for supply chain flexibility.
